项目摘要
The hippocampal formation and prefrontal cortex (PFC) have both been
demonstrated to participate in working memory processes, and the
hippocampo-prefrontal pathway has been suggested to play an important
developmental role in the pathology of schizophrenia. Dopamine (DA)
afferents from the ventral tegmental area (VTA) have also been implicated
in the learning and memory functions of the hippocampus and the PFC, and
dysfunction of ascending DA projections has been suggested to be involved
in the neuropathology of schizophrenia. It is not known, however, whether
DA afferents are able to modulate hippocampo-prefrontal transmission. The
proposed research will utilize in vivo neurophysiological methods in rats
to examine the ability of DA, applied locally or released by VTA
stimulation. to act on this pathway both at the cell body level and in
the terminal field. In Study 1, the actions of DA will be recorded on
hippocampal neurons identified as projecting to the PFC. In Study 2, the
ability of DA to modulate the response of PFC neurons to hippocampal
stimulation will be examined. In Study 3, the ability of DA to act
presynaptically on hippocampal terminals will be examined by recording
the terminal excitability of hippocampal afferents to the PFC. The
mechanisms of DA action that are identified in these studies will improve
the understanding of its role in cognitive and affective functions, as
well as its potential contribution to the pathophysiology and treatment
of psychiatric and neurological disorders.
